I am so sorry that you’re experiencing the tiresome ordeal of getting an endometriosis diagnosis, unfortunately the statistic that it takes seven years for us to get diagnosed was true for me in Brisbane.

I don’t know if my advice is going to be particularly helpful, but my experience sent me down the private health insurance road and I started getting more answers that way.

They found mine accidentally through a hernia repair at STARS after bouncing back and forth between the emergency department and GP with scary pain episodes for three years while I waited for elective surgery. Only after I had that histology report did anyone, including my GP, take me seriously. I signed up for private health and had the surgical consult with the excision specialist at Greenslopes Hospital. After my first lap it was okay for awhile but kept my private health and was glad I did because I’ve been using it for fertility and endometriosis management out of a specialist at Eve health now.

Ultrasound didn’t diagnose my stage three endo at QWUF, but my specialist at Eve has been able to track changes in my pelvis with ultrasound.

Not all endometriosis specialists are created equal. There are some specialists that have made a living butchering women that we discuss amongst my friendship groups. My top tip would be to make sure that your surgeon uses excision rather than ablation. A very thorough Google and trawl through Rate MD for gynaecologist in Brisbane is a good way to work out experiences patients have had.
